Abstract

This study aims to analyze the importance of English communication skills for accounting students in the era of artificial intelligence. The development of artificial intelligence has changed accounting education and professional practice, especially in financial reporting, data analysis, auditing, and the use of digital accounting tools. In this context, accounting students need English communication skills to support their academic understanding and professional readiness. This study used a qualitative descriptive method with a literature review approach. The data were obtained from relevant previous studies related to English communication skills, accounting education, artificial intelligence, digital accounting, and career readiness. The findings show that English communication skills support accounting students in five main aspects: understanding international accounting terminology, accessing global academic references, using English-based accounting software and AI tools, preparing financial and academic reports, and communicating professionally in global business contexts. The study also indicates that limited English communication competence may reduce students’ ability to adapt to digital and AI-driven accounting practices. Therefore, integrating English communication training into accounting education is necessary to prepare accounting students to become more adaptive, competent, and competitive in future accounting careers.
